March 2026
available places: 67
buy ticket
available places: 96
buy ticketApril 2026
available places: 152
buy ticket
available places: 179
buy ticket
available places: 143
buy ticket
available places: 109
buy ticketMay 2026
available places: 248
buy ticket
available places: 250
buy ticket
available places: 205
buy ticket
available places: 228
buy ticket
available places: 206
buy ticket
available places: 219
buy ticket